编程中16d什么意思
-
在编程中,16d通常是表示16进制数的意思。在计算机科学中,我们通常使用10进制(十进制)来表示数字,也就是我们常见的0-9的数字系统。而在16进制数系统中,我们使用0-9以及A-F来表示数字,其中A表示10,B表示11,以此类推,F表示15。因此,16d表示的是一个16进制的数字。在编程中,我们经常使用16进制数来表示内存地址、颜色值、字符编码等。
1年前 -
在编程中,16d通常是指十六进制数。在计算机科学和编程中,数字可以用不同的进制表示,其中十六进制是一种常见的表示方式。在十六进制中,数字由0-9和字母A-F组成,其中A代表10,B代表11,以此类推,直到F代表15。
以下是关于16d的一些重要信息:
-
表示方式:在编程中,十六进制数通常以0x开头。例如,0x10表示十进制的16,0x1F表示十进制的31。
-
二进制对应关系:每位十六进制数对应于四位二进制数。例如,十六进制的0对应二进制的0000,十六进制的F对应二进制的1111。
-
内存地址:在编程中,内存地址通常以十六进制表示。这是因为内存地址是由硬件分配的,而硬件通常使用十六进制数来编码地址。
-
颜色表示:在图形编程中,十六进制数也常用于表示颜色。例如,HTML和CSS中,颜色值可以使用十六进制表示,如#FF0000表示红色。
-
数据传输:在计算机网络和通信中,十六进制数也常用于表示数据的传输。例如,在网络调试中,我们可以查看十六进制表示的数据包,以便分析和调试网络通信问题。
总结:在编程中,16d通常是指十六进制数。十六进制数在计算机科学和编程中具有广泛的应用,包括表示数字、内存地址、颜色和数据传输等方面。
1年前 -
-
在编程中,16d是表示16进制数的一种表示方式。d代表decimal(十进制),表示后面的数字是以16进制表示的。
16进制是一种计数系统,使用16个数字来表示数值,分别是0、1、2、3、4、5、6、7、8、9、A、B、C、D、E、F。其中,A代表10,B代表11,以此类推。
在16进制中,每一位的权值是16的幂,从右向左依次是16^0、16^1、16^2、16^3……以此类推。例如,16d的意思是16进制的数,其中d表示decimal,表示后面的数字是以16进制表示的。
使用16进制表示数值可以简化数字的表达方式,尤其在处理二进制数据时很常见。在编程中,可以使用0x前缀来表示16进制数。例如,0x10表示16进制的数16。
在操作中,将16进制数转换为其他进制数可以使用相应的转换方法。例如,将16进制数转换为10进制数可以使用乘法和加法运算。以16d为例,将其转换为10进制数的方法如下:
- 将16进制数的每一位按照权值展开,从右向左依次是16^0、16^1、16^2、16^3……以此类推。
- 将每一位的数值乘以对应的权值,然后相加得到最终的结果。
以16d为例,展开后是:(6 * 16^0) + (1 * 16^1) = 6 + 16 = 22。所以16d转换为10进制数是22。
类似地,将16进制数转换为2进制数可以使用二进制的位权法。将16进制数的每一位转换为4位的二进制数,然后拼接起来即可。
总之,16d在编程中表示16进制数的一种表示方式,可以通过相应的转换方法将其转换为其他进制数。
1年前